Paul KaplanPaul Kaplan is Professor of Art History at Purchase College, SUNY. He is the author of Contraband Guides: Race, Transatlantic Culture, and the Arts in the Civil War Era, also published by Penn State University Press and TheRise of the Black Magus in Western Art, and a contributor to The Image of the Black in Western Art. He served as Project Scholar for Fred Wilson’s Speak of Me as I Am, an installation in the American Pavilion of the 2003 Venice Biennale. Read More Read Less
